THE Fylingdales Group of Artists opens its annual exhibition at Pannett Park Art Gallery tomorrow.
The Fylingdales Group of Artists is always an eagerly awaited and a high quality exhibition with works from some of the north of England's leading artists.
It includes David Curtis, from Doncaster, David Allen, from Harrogate, and Jack Rigg from Leeds.
Whitby artists John Freeman and Christine Pybus are also among the exhibiting group members.
The group was founded in 1925 and famous past group members include Dame Ethel Walker from Robin Hood's Bay and Algernon Newton who lived at Goathland and is best remembered locally for painting the Birch Hall Inn pub sign at Beck Hole.
Several members of the Staithes Group of Artists later became members of the Fylingdales Group.
The exhibition opens to the public tomorrow and runs until Wednesday 8 July.
